Focusing on the engineering and technological aspects, this project involves the development of a remote-controlled hovercraft as part of an academic course. It builds on prior work and aims to create an autonomous vehicle capable of lifting a payload of 1.5kg while consuming a maximum of 35W of power. The hovercraft utilizes propeller-generated airflow and features a skirt for lift. Control is achieved through a PlayStation 3 gamepad, enabling wireless communication between the base station and the hovercraft's onboard remote station.
